Common Wood Window Service Jobs
Wood window repair - restoring damaged or rotted wood components for improved function and appearance.
Window restoration - preserving historic or antique wood windows to maintain their original charm.
Wood window replacement - installing new wood frames to enhance energy efficiency and curb appeal.
Custom wood window fabrication - creating tailored wood windows to match specific architectural styles.
Wood window reglazing - replacing damaged or aging glass to improve insulation and clarity.
Wood window maintenance - cleaning, sealing, and protecting wood surfaces to extend lifespan.
Wood Window Service Questions
What types of wood windows are serviced? Services cover a variety of wood window styles, including double-hung, casement, and picture windows commonly found in homes and commercial buildings.
Can damaged wood windows be repaired? Yes, minor to moderate damage such as rot, cracks, or warping can often be repaired to restore window integrity and appearance.
Are there options to improve energy efficiency? Upgrades like weatherstripping, adding storm windows, or refinishing can enhance insulation and reduce drafts in existing wood windows.
What work is typically requested for wood window services? Common projects include repairs, refinishing, restoration, and installation of new or replacement wood windows to match existing styles.
